Estimated Blood Sugar Response

Japanese Stir Fry Yakisoba Sauce, Japanese Stir Fry vs Thai And True, Massamum Curry Paste comparison: Japanese Stir Fry Yakisoba Sauce, Japanese Stir Fry has a moderate blood sugar impact (BSI 16.0) while Thai And True, Massamum Curry Paste has minimal impact (BSI 2.0). Japanese Stir Fry Yakisoba Sauce, Japanese Stir Fry contains 7.0g more carbs per serving. Consider Thai And True, Massamum Curry Paste for better blood sugar control.
